So apart from yearn for chocolate and that hot bloke, this is what I did...

Gelli plate base using Leafy Swirl stencil.

Used up some UTEE that was sat in my Meltpot to make the tiles, added a touch of Gilding wax.

Tiny bit of stamping with my Clarity Dragonfly.

An air dry clay fern leaf, sprayed beige to tone it down.

And some yummy flowers from Sweet Lilac, I sprayed the Poinsettia to tone them down and pretend they're not Christmas flowers!

Pins, pearls, twine, done!
